Spotted Owlet, Athene brama indica, 21 cm / 8.26 in. Widespread resident around habitation and cultivation. India Pakistan, Nepal, Bhutan and Bangladesh. Handheld. Thanks, Mike!

Eastern Range, Kaziranga National Park, Assam Province, India.

Black Drongo, Dicrurus macrocercus albirictus, 28 cm / 11.02 in. COMMON and widespread resident near human habitations and cultivation. Handheld.

Eastern Range, Kaziranga National Park, Assam Province, India.

Black Kites (Black-eared), Milvus migrans lineatus, 58-66 cm / 22.83-25.98 in. Widespread resident. Might have been 60-70 kites scavenging at this garbage site. Handheld.

At the very birdy Gorchuk Dump outside of Guwahati, Assam Province, India.

Blue-throated Barbet, Megalaima asiaticus asiaticus, 23 cm / 9.05 in. Resident of the Himalayas, NE India and Bangladesh in moist, broadleaved subtropical and temperate forest. Handheld.

Seen among the landscaping of the Assam State Zoological Gardens, Assam Province, India.
